Job 31:1

"I have made a covenant with my eyes; how then could I gaze at a virgin?

1 John 2:16

For all that is in the world--the desires of the flesh and the desires of the eyes and pride in possessions--is not from the Father but is from the world.

2 Samuel 11:2-4

It happened, late one afternoon, when David arose from his couch and was walking on the roof of the king's house, that he saw from the roof a woman bathing; and the woman was very beautiful.

Psalm 119:37

Turn my eyes from looking at worthless things; and give me life in your ways.

Proverbs 4:25

Let your eyes look directly forward, and your gaze be straight before you.

Proverbs 6:25

Do not desire her beauty in your heart, and do not let her capture you with her eyelashes;

Matthew 5:28-29

But I say to you that everyone who looks at a woman with lustful intent has already committed adultery with her in his heart.

James 1:14-15

But each person is tempted when he is lured and enticed by his own desire.

Genesis 6:2

the sons of God saw that the daughters of man were attractive. And they took as their wives any they chose.

Proverbs 23:31-33

Do not look at wine when it is red, when it sparkles in the cup and goes down smoothly.
